About 1,1,2,2-tetrafluoropropylbenzene

1,1,2,2-tetrafluoropropylbenzene (PubChem CID 23233426) has the molecular formula C9H8F4 and a molecular weight of 192.16 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1,1,2,2-tetrafluoropropylbenzene.
